在这个信息爆炸的时代,理解和掌握RAM(随机存取存储器)的实用实现与高效调用技巧,对于提升计算机性能和优化程序运行至关重要。以下是一些帮助你轻松学会这些技巧的方法和步骤。
了解RAM的基础知识
首先,我们需要明确RAM的基本概念和它在计算机系统中的作用。
RAM基础知识:
- 定义:RAM是一种电子存储器,用于在计算机上存储当前正在使用的数据和指令。
- 类型:主要有DRAM(动态RAM)和SRAM(静态RAM)两种。
- 特性:RAM的特点是读写速度快,但断电后数据会丢失。
步骤一:掌握RAM的工作原理
为了高效调用RAM,我们需要了解它是如何工作的。
工作原理:
- 存储单元:RAM由许多存储单元组成,每个单元可以存储一定数量的位(bit)。
- 地址寻址:通过地址总线,CPU可以寻址到RAM中的任何单元。
- 数据读写:CPU通过数据总线向RAM写入数据或从RAM读取数据。
实践中的RAM实现
步骤二:理解内存条的安装与配置
正确安装和配置内存条是确保RAM性能的关键。
安装与配置:
- 选择合适的内存条:根据计算机的型号和系统需求,选择合适的内存条。
- 安装内存条:打开机箱,找到内存插槽,将内存条正确插入。
- 设置BIOS/UEFI:进入BIOS/UEFI设置,调整内存频率和时序参数。
步骤三:使用内存管理工具
掌握一些内存管理工具可以帮助你更好地监控和优化RAM的使用。
内存管理工具:
- Windows任务管理器:查看内存使用情况,结束进程。
- Windows内存诊断工具:检查内存错误。
- 第三方工具:如RAMMap,提供更详细的内存使用分析。
高效调用RAM的技巧
步骤四:优化内存分配
合理分配内存可以提高程序性能。
优化内存分配:
- 避免内存泄漏:确保不再需要的内存被及时释放。
- 使用合适的数据结构:选择适合数据访问模式的数据结构。
- 缓存技术:合理使用缓存,减少对RAM的直接访问。
步骤五:减少内存碎片
内存碎片会导致内存使用效率降低。
减少内存碎片:
- 定期进行磁盘碎片整理:虽然针对硬盘,但也能间接影响内存。
- 合理分配内存:尽量将数据连续存储,避免碎片化。
步骤六:利用虚拟内存
虚拟内存是当物理RAM不足时,操作系统自动使用硬盘空间作为补充的机制。
利用虚拟内存:
- 调整虚拟内存设置:在Windows中,可以手动调整虚拟内存的大小。
- 选择合适的磁盘:作为虚拟内存的硬盘应具有较快的读写速度。
总结
通过上述步骤,你将能够轻松学会RAM的实用实现与高效调用技巧。记住,实践是关键,不断尝试和调整,你将能更深入地理解并掌握这些技巧。记住,每一次的优化都可能让你的计算机运行得更加流畅。